Today's consumers are more health-conscious and value comfort alongside style. Brands that focus on sustainable materials and inclusive sizing are gaining traction, making it essential for suppliers to adapt their product lines to meet these expectations.
E-commerce continues to revolutionize the lingerie industry. B2B suppliers can leverage online platforms to reach global markets more efficiently than traditional methods. Initiatives like drop shipping or wholesale marketplaces can enable manufacturers to expand their reach without substantial investment.

With the lingerie market's growth, several trade opportunities arise:
Participating in international trade shows can expose your brand to potential buyers and partners. Events like the Paris lingerie show attract global attention and can significantly boost your market presence.
Establishing partnerships with retailers worldwide can provide a steady stream of orders. Wholesalers must focus on building strong relationships to ensure long-term success.
